Why Cats Seem to Ignore You – The Science Behind Their Playful Moods

Cats often surprise us by slipping into a quiet corner one moment and then leaping onto our lap the next. Rather than being capricious, this behaviour is rooted in feline biology and social strategy.

1. Cats Are Naturally Independent

Unlike dogs, which have been selectively bred for thousands of years to thrive on companionship, domestic cats evolved as semi‑solitary hunters. Their instinctual need for personal space means they choose when to engage, not when we expect them to.

2. They’re Observing, Not Ignoring

What looks like aloofness is actually a keen observation. Cats monitor our tone, movements, and routine to gauge safety and opportunity. This subtle “surveillance” helps them decide whether to approach for food, play, or affection.

3. Attention on Their Terms = Control

When a cat demands attention, it’s a power play. Forced affection often triggers a tail flick or withdrawal. In contrast, when they choose the moment, they become irresistibly endearing, reinforcing the cycle of selective engagement.

4. You’re More Interesting When You’re Busy

Busy moments create a perfect distraction for cats. Your laptop’s warmth and your focus make you a living target for play or cuddles, turning the situation into a reverse‑psychology moment that keeps them intrigued.

5. They’re Just Not in the Mood… Until They Are

Cats experience mood swings similar to humans. Factors like fatigue, overstimulation, or stress can make them briefly uninterested. Once their internal threshold shifts, they’ll drop into affectionate mode.

6. They Might Be Testing Boundaries

Some felines deliberately distance themselves to gauge your reaction. This passive‑aggressive check ensures they’re treated fairly—often followed by a treat reward once you adjust.

7. Affection Windows Are Brief but Intense

Each cat has a personal affection window, sometimes only a few seconds. Missing this window can result in a quiet retreat, but when it opens, it’s usually full‑blown purring and head‑butts.

8. Headbutts, Licks, and Bites: Mixed Signals

These behaviors are layered signals of affection, curiosity, and social bonding. While they can seem chaotic, they’re often a cat’s way of interacting on their own terms.

9. Your Cat Might Be Trying to Communicate Something

Sudden changes in engagement—either increased clinginess or persistent aloofness—may indicate underlying stress, discomfort, or illness. Monitoring these shifts can be crucial for early intervention.

10. They Love You – Just in Their Own Way

Love in cats is expressed through slow blinks, gentle nudges, and calm presence. Understanding this subtle communication helps strengthen the human‑cat bond and reduces misinterpretation.

Final Meow: It’s All Part of the Game

Their hot‑and‑cold patterns are not spite but adaptive behaviour shaped by evolution and daily life. Recognizing this explains why we’re drawn back to them time and again.
